Jenny filled 12 pitchers with an equal amount in each. The total amount of lemonade in the 12 pitchers was 41.4 liters. How many liters of lemonade would be in 7 pitchers?

To find out how many liters of lemonade would be in 7 pitchers, we can use ratios and proportions to solve this problem.

First, we need to find the amount of lemonade in one pitcher. Since all 12 pitchers have an equal amount, we can divide the total amount of lemonade (41.4 liters) by the number of pitchers (12).

Amount of lemonade in one pitcher = 41.4 liters / 12 pitchers = 3.45 liters/pitcher

Now that we know the amount of lemonade in one pitcher is 3.45 liters, we can find the amount in 7 pitchers. We will use the same ratio as before.

Amount of lemonade in 7 pitchers = 3.45 liters/pitcher × 7 pitchers = 24.15 liters

Therefore, there will be 24.15 liters of lemonade in 7 pitchers.
